Analysis

The most recent figure for completion rate, lower secondary education, urban — value — female in Nepal is 79.22 %, measured in 2021.

That represents a change of down 2.0% on the previous year and up 3.0% over ten years.

Over the whole period, completion rate, lower secondary education, urban — value — female in Nepal peaked at 84.87 % in 2014 and was at its lowest, 57.64 %, in 2007.

That places Nepal 53rd out of 73 countries with data for 2021, putting it in the middle of the range.

The Suite of Gender Indicators presents a set of indicators relevant to agrifood systems that are disaggregated by sex, with the aim of highlighting gender differences across agrifood systems. The initial set of indicators is based on those used in FAO’s 2023 Status of Women in Agrifood Systems (SWAFS) report and on the recommendations of an expert consultation held in December 2023, and covers key dimensions including economic participation, governance, agency, social norms, assets and services, education, health, and nutrition. Indicator selection was informed by expert judgment and by the availability of data with sufficient geographic and temporal coverage to enable meaningful comparisons across regions and over time. While most indicators are produced and published by FAO and other international organizations, the objective of this domain is to provide a one-stop shop for sex-disaggregated data on agrifood systems.
